Instant Pot Broccoli Beef

Instant Pot Broccoli Beef is everything you love about my Slow Cooker Broccoli Beef but much faster and with double the sauce — because who doesn’t love this delicious, tangy, sweet, garlicky sauce over a bed of rice or noodles?

Ingredients

  • 1 ½-2 pounds thin-sliced stir-fry steak cut into 2-inch pieces
  • 2 cups beef broth
  • 1 ⅓ cups low sodium soy sauce
  • cup brown sugar
  • 2 tablespoons sesame oil
  • 1-2 tablespoons minced garlic
  • ½ te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es optional
  • 4-6 cups frozen broccoli florets see note for fresh broccoli
  • 4-5 tablespoons corn starch + 1/3 cup cold water

Instructions

  • In your pot, combine meat, beef broth, soy sauce, brown sugar, sesame oil, garlic, and red pepper flakes and give it a good stir.
  • Place the lid on the pot and slide into the lock position. Turn the vent knob to the SEALED position.
  • Set to PRESSURE COOK or MANUAL for 8 minutes. (remember that it will take a few minutes for the pot to pressurize before it starts counting down)
  • When the cook time is up, turn knob to the VENTING position. Once float valve drops down, remove the lid.
  • Set the pot to the SOUP setting. In a small bowl stir together cold water and corn starch. When liquid comes to a boil in the pot, stir in corn starch slurry. Turn the pot off (hit CANCEL or unplug it) and allow the sauce to thicken for 2-3 minutes.
  • Stir in broccoli florets until heated through, 3-5 minutes. Serve over rice or noodles.

Notes

If using fresh broccoli, place in a bowl, cover with plastic wrap, pierce 2-3 times with a fork and then microwave for 2-3 minutes until fork-tender.
